Scouts are highly encouraged to wear uniforms to our regular troop and patrol meetings. New uniforms may be ordered from a Scout Shop in the United States or through the Far East Council; some components, such as the Troop 60 neckerchief, are provided by or available for purchase through the Troop. For more specific information about uniform requirements, please visit Scouting America's website or ask your Scoutmaster!
